About the Book

Interstellar Dust by Endrik Krugel provides a comprehensive theoretical description of the fundamental physics behind interstellar dust grains. These grains play a crucial role in various processes within astrophysics, including chemical reactions, light absorption and scattering, and the formation of planetary bodies. Understanding the physics of interstellar dust is essential for astronomers and astrophysicists to explain the behavior of light through molecular clouds, the collapse of clouds, and the formation of stars and galaxies.

Key Topics Covered:

  • Fundamental Physics of Interstellar Dust: Detailed coverage of the physics of interstellar dust, including solid-state physics, radiative transport, optical properties, thermodynamics, and quantum mechanics.

  • Dust Grain Properties: The book explores the composition, morphology, size distribution, dynamics, and alignment of dust grains.

  • Optical and Thermal Properties: An in-depth look at the optical and thermal properties of dust grains, including how they absorb, scatter, polarize, and re-radiate starlight.

  • Catalysis and Chemical Reactions: Interstellar dust's role in catalyzing simple chemical reactions and its importance in the formation of planets and stars.

  • Astrophysical Implications: How dust affects the light passing through molecular clouds and how it contributes to the spectral behavior of protostars and star-forming regions.
